We have a lot of wild elderberry, and they grow and bloom luxuriently but I have never seen them set fruit. The blossoms simply drop. What is up here?

My guess -not pollinated, try planting a few commercial varieties to add a source of pollen, Adams , Johns etc.
Be sure you have elderberry, some plants mimic them and may be seriously poisonous. Some types of wild elderberries don't set fruit. some need particualr cultivars for cross polination.
